China-headquartered project logistics firm Protranser has delivered workover rigs from Lianyungang, China to Kuwait.
More than 9,300 cu m of workover rigs were delivered, totalling 243 pieces with a combined weight of 1,850 tonnes. The heaviest piece weighed 62 tonnes.
Protranser was responsible for port services, Customs declaration, as well as providing surveys and chartering the breakbulk vessel that was used to transport the cargo.
Despite the rigs arriving late at the port after the vessel had berthed, Protranser coordinated with the port authority and Customs to ensure that the cargo’s packing was carried out within the limited timeframe it had available.
Back in 2023, Protranser coordinated the delivery of 3,421 cu m of cargo from Türkiye to Kuwait. More recently, the company teamed up with Sea Cargo Air Cargo Logistics (SCACLI) to ship transformers from China to Canada.
